js,jq,php使用正则方法

1.js使用正则表达式案例:

<script>
var str=”543535364565@qq.com”;
var res=“/^\d*@(QQ|qq|136)\.(com|cn)$/”;
var result=res.exec(str);
alert(result);
</script>

2.php使用正则表达式案例:

$email_address =”543535364565@qq.com”;
$pattern =“/^\d*@(QQ|qq|136)\.(com|cn)$/”;
if ( preg_match( $pattern, $email_address ) )
{
$reply = “您输入的电子邮件地址合法”;
}
else
{
$reply = “您输入的电子邮件地址不合法”;
}

echo $reply;

3.jquery正则表达式验证:

<script>
var str=”543535364565@qq.com”;

if (!str.match(/^\d*@(QQ|qq|136)\.(com|cn)$/)) {
alert(“邮箱格式不正确”);
return false;
}
return true;
}

</script>

 

posted @ 2017-06-16 01:27  づ開始懂了。  阅读(179)  评论(0编辑  收藏  举报